## Deploying the Gatewick Proctor Queue

Deploys are pretty painless: push to main, wait for the pipeline, then watch the queue drain dashboard for five minutes. If candidates pile up mid-exam, roll back first and ask questions later — the queue replays safely. Everything the workers care about lives in one config block, shown here for reference.

settings of bafof-yagef:
JOROX_PIN=8740
JOROX_TENANT=pelox
JOROX_METRICS_HOST=metrics.jorox.qorvelworks.internal
JOROX_SEAL=seal_c78f63c1
JOROX_STANDBY_TEAM=norax

## Runbook: Connection Pool Changes

Plugin authors integrating with the Ostermill data layer: release 7.1 caps per-plugin pool size at twelve connections and enforces a two-second acquisition timeout. Audit your plugins for long-held connections and release them promptly, or requests will queue and time out. After updating, run the pool stress check in the sandbox. Signed plugin packages only — sign your archive with the key below.

release key, fafof-hawip: bky6_52YEwQ

**Q: Map tiles look stale or garbled — what do I do?**

Nine times out of ten it's the Glazecache layer serving expired tiles after a renderer restart. Don't flush the whole cache — that melts the Fernhollow renderers. Instead, invalidate just the affected zoom levels via the admin task. Step-by-step instructions are on the internal page below.

wiki page, tahaf-tajog: https://jira.ordindyn.corp/pipeline

### Step 6 — Ship the Draftwire Undo Fix

This build restores multi-step redo after paste operations in Draftwire's diagram canvas. Support should confirm with reporters that redo history no longer clears on paste. Deploy only the signed bundle; the updater refuses unsigned artifacts. Before uploading, sign the bundle using the release key below.

deploy key for kajof-fajop: bky6_gDHw9Q